The Second Billion Smartphone Users

Burmese_daysI speak with little fear of contradiction when I tell you this is the first TechCrunch article posted from Myanmar aka Burma. Only a few years ago the Internet here was both tightly censored and insanely slow. But now that this country is "on the path to democracy," according to Daw Aung Sun Suu Kyi herself, Free Wi-Fi signs are widespread, and its Internet is freewheeling and ... merely incredibly slow. So slow that it often reminds me of the 2400 baud modems of yore. Progress!
